“My wife and as New Mexican natives have searched far and wide on our travels for “real New Mexican food”. Santa Fe BK is unquestionably the best we have had. John and Melissa, the owners did their research and it shows in the food. The place itself is charming, especially the outdoor patio with “Betty” the apple tree anchoring it. Owners were very friendly and knowledgeable. Their Chimayo red and Hatch green chiles (the heart of New Mexican cooking) were excellent. We’ll definitely be back on our next NY trip.“
